What Is ROFR?
ROFR (Right of First Refusal) is a legal right held by certain landowners or tenants, particularly in tribal areas. It gives them the first opportunity to purchase land if it is being sold. In Andhra Pradesh, Meebhoomi provides access to this important information as part of its land records service. Common ROFR Search Errors on Meebhoomi

Before diving into the solutions, let’s take a look at the common errors users face while searching for ROFR data:
No Results Found: You might see a message stating “No data available for the entered details” when trying to search.
Incorrect Data Displayed: Sometimes, the ROFR search results might show outdated or inaccurate information.
Server Errors: A “Server Error” message can appear when Meebhoomi fails to process the ROFR query due to server issues.
Search Timeouts: Sometimes, searches take too long to complete or time out completely, leading to frustration.
These errors can occur for various reasons, such as issues with the input data, Meebhoomi server overloads, or discrepancies in the land records.
How to Fix ROFR Search Errors on Meebhoomi Portal
If you’re facing errors while searching for ROFR records, try the following solutions:
The most common reason for ROFR search errors is entering incorrect or incomplete information. Make sure you enter the following correctly:
- Beneficiary ID or Plot ID: Double-check these details before submitting the search.
- Village Name: Ensure the correct village or area name is entered.
- Account Number: If applicable, verify that your account number is accurate.
If any of these details are incorrect or incomplete, you’ll likely receive no results or incorrect data.
If you’ve entered the correct information but still face errors, try clearing your browser’s cache and cookies:
- Google Chrome:
- Open Chrome.
- Click on the three dots (menu) in the top-right corner.
- Go to More tools > Clear browsing data.
- Select Cookies and other site data and Cached images and files.
- Click Clear data.
After clearing the cache, refresh the Meebhoomi portal page and try the search again.
Sometimes, browser compatibility issues can cause errors. If the search isn’t working in your current browser, try using a different browser such as Google Chrome, Mozilla Firefox, or Microsoft Edge. Meebhoomi works better with some browsers than others, so switching might solve the problem.
At times, server overloads can cause errors when using the portal, especially during peak usage times. If you’re getting server errors or timeout messages, try performing the search at a different time, such as early morning or late evening, when the portal might have less traffic.
If there’s a system update or maintenance happening on Meebhoomi, it can affect search functionality. Check the official Meebhoomi website or local news for any maintenance announcements. If the system is undergoing an update, the issue should resolve once the maintenance is complete.
If none of the above steps work and you’re still encountering issues with the ROFR search, it’s time to reach out to Meebhoomi support. You can contact the customer support team via:
Mee-Seva Centers: Visit a Mee-Seva center for in-person assistance with your ROFR search.
Phone: Call your local Meebhoomi support number.
Email: Send an email explaining the issue and asking for assistance.
